mm/ksm: convert get_mergeable_page() from follow_page() to folio_walk
Let's use folio_walk instead, for example avoiding taking temporary folio references if the folio does not even apply and getting rid of one more follow_page() user. Note that zeropages obviously don't apply: old code could just have specified FOLL_DUMP. Anon folios are never secretmem, so we don't care about losing the check in follow_page().
